This job involves leading a team of nurses and medical assistants in a youth detention clinic, overseeing daily operations, staff training, and patient care for young people with limited access to healthcare.
The role focuses on improving processes, ensuring compliance with health standards, and promoting equity in a supportive, justice-oriented environment.
It's ideal for an experienced registered nurse who enjoys supervising teams, handling complex cases, and contributing to social justice initiatives in a government setting.
Requirements:
Bachelor's degree in nursing science or a graduate level nursing degree of MSN, DNP or PhD from an accredited school of nursing.
Current Washington State license as a Registered Nurse or Multi-State Licensure.
Documentation of current BLS-CPR for Health Care Providers. CPR/AED HeartSaver courses do not meet this requirement.
Washington state driver's license or ability to travel to sites within the county.
Pass background and credentialing; including complete King County personnel file & disciplinary file review.
Current career service qualified registered nurse employed within the Dept. of Adult & Juvenile Detention - Juvenile Division only.
Work Schedule: This 1.0 FTE, fully benefitted career service position and has a typical work schedule of 1100 -1900, Monday through Friday.
This position is overtime eligible and may work outside of the typical schedule to meet operational needs. Work Location: King County Juvenile Detention Center, 1211 E. Alder, Seattle, WA, 98122.
The individual selected for this position will work within the secure perimeter of the juvenile detention facility.
